
Once again, the SFTARC is planning an operating event from the Tallgrass Prairie National Preserve near Strong City, KS. This year we are planning on a Saturday, April 18th, POTA (Parks on the Air) activation with two HF SSB stations and one CW station.
The core team will meet in Gardner at about 5:50 am and then convoy down to the Tallgrass, stopping at BETO Junction (Hwy 75 and I-35) for breakfast. Those who wish to travel individually could meet the rest of the SFTARC team at BETO or at the Tallgrass on their own schedule. The goal is to arrive at the Tallgrass by 9 am and have at least one station on the air by 10 am. Members take turns operating the stations and logging contacts, with everyone participating in the setup and the take down of the stations. We are usually taking down the stations between 2 and 3 pm, returning to the Olathe area generally before 6 pm.
These Tallgrass operations have been enjoyable events for the club. The National Park Service has been delighted to host us, and we often get curious questions from park visitors--making the event good PR for amateur radio. And while you are there, you may want to take in some of the park exhibits or walk one of the walking trails.
